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ask North Oldham). They blew past the South Oldham Dragons 15-5 on Wednesday.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est victory the Mustangs have posted against the Dragons since May 7, 2021.
The win made it two in a row for North Oldham and bumps their season record up to 11-7. Those victories came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ered a grand total of 6 runs in those games. As for South Oldham,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ost four of their last five mat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 5-10 record this season.
North Oldham will square off against Anderson County at 6:30 p.m. on Friday. The timing is sure in the Mustangs' favor as the team sits on five straight wins at home while the Bearcats have been banged up by five consecutive losses on the road. As for South Oldham, they will head out to square off against Bardstown at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. The Dragons are facing the Tigers at the right time seeing as the Tigers are stuck on a three-game losing streak.
